What is the main difference between medieval and Renaissance music?

Medieval music was mostly plainchant; first monophonic then developed into polyphonic. Renaissance music was largely buoyant melodies. Medieval music was mostly only vocal while renaissance music was of both instrumental and vocal; flutes, harps, violins were some of the instruments used.

What is the difference between mediaeval and medieval?

When it comes to choosing medieval or mediaeval, it has been commonly observed people in Great Britain were more willing to use the ae, while Americans preferred just using the e. By the middle of the twentieth-century it was clear that medieval would be the common spelling.

What are two differences between Greek or Roman and medieval sculpture?

The Romans took many elements from Greek art but brought a more naturalistic and ostentatious style. Where Greek statues and sculptures depict calm, ideal figures in the nude, Roman sculpture is highly decorative and more concerned with realistic depictions of individuals.

What are the different medieval?

Generally, the medieval era is divided into three periods: the Early Middle Ages, the High Middle Ages, and the Late Middle Ages. Like the Middle Ages itself, each of these three periods lacks hard and fast parameters.

What is the difference between Roman and Middle Ages thinking?

One: Roman thinking was focussed on enjoying life while it lasts – mostly because their image of an afterlife was a gloomy, grey place for both good and bad people. In the Middle Ages however, life was considered a “valley of tears”, only an opportunity to make sure you get into heaven by enduring as much suffering as you can.
